🎯 Key Features Implemented

1. Partition-Based Extension System

  • Uses existing OTA partitions (app0/app1)
  • No partition table changes required
  • Maintains OTA update compatibility

2. Manual Partition Swap Return

  • NOT using bootloader rollback (disabled in Arduino ESP32)
  • Uses esp_ota_set_boot_partition() + esp_restart()
  • Dynamic partition detection (handles "ping-pong" problem)

3. RTC Boot Counter Watchdog

  • Prevents soft-brick from bad extensions
  • Auto-return to launcher after 3 failed boots
  • Resets counter on successful user-initiated exit

4. Safety Guardrails

  • Battery check (>20%) before flashing
  • Magic byte validation (0xE9)
  • Partition size validation
  • File existence checks
  • Error handling with user-friendly messages

5. SD Card App Structure

/.crosspoint/apps/{app-name}/
├── app.json    # Manifest (name, version, description, author, minFirmware)
└── app.bin     # Compiled firmware binary

⚠️ Known Limitations

  1. No Bootloader Rollback: Arduino ESP32 has rollback disabled, so we use manual partition swap
  2. No Sandboxing: Extensions have full hardware access (trusted apps only)
  3. Flash Wear: Each app switch writes to flash (limited erase cycles)
  4. Single App Slot: Only one extension can be loaded at a time
  5. No App Icons: Phase 2 feature
  6. No WiFi Download: Phase 2 feature
